Raja Gadhowa Population - Morigaon, Assam
Raja Gadhowa is a large village located in Laharighat Circle of Morigaon district, Assam with total 509 families residing. The Raja Gadhowa village has population of 3074 of which 1570 are males while 1504 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Raja Gadhowa village population of children with age 0-6 is 633 which makes up 20.59 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Raja Gadhowa village is 958 which is equal than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Raja Gadhowa as per census is 948, lower than Assam average of 962.
Raja Gadhowa village has lower liter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Raja Gadhowa village was 56.29 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Raja Gadhowa Male literacy stands at 56.39 % while female literacy rate was 56.19 %.

Raja Gadhowa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 509 | - | - |
Population | 3,074 | 1,570 | 1,504 |
Child (0-6) | 633 | 325 | 308 |
Schedule Caste | 4 | 2 | 2 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 56.29 % | 56.39 % | 56.19 % |
Total Workers | 741 | 731 | 10 |
Main Worker | 656 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 85 | 82 | 3 |
